Role Description

As the Product Manager responsible for search quality, you will ensure that customer’s content is not only safe but also discoverable to deliver a delightful experience in Dropbox’s core product. To do so, you’ll work hand-in-hand with engineering to define metrics, set targets, prioritize work, run and evaluate experiments, and validate the overall success of search. You will pose and answer questions about when to use machine learning and when to use heuristics. You will help engineering assess the importance of engineering investments as they relate to long-term goals. In doing so, you will define how Dropbox addresses search quality, not just take over an existing process.

In order to be successful in our Virtual First environment we needed to make changes that would allow employees to have more control over both where and how they work. Therefore, we embrace “non-linear workdays” with defined core collaboration hours that overlap across time zones. Beyond that, we encourage employees to design their own schedules to balance collaboration with needs for individual focus. We’ve also moved from “all day syncs” to an “async by default” culture, reserving meetings for discussion, debate, and decision-making, and handling all other work in our deep focus hours.
